		<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>@Erin, thanks for your response.  I haven&#8217;t considered the Pontiac Vibe, but I&#8217;m going to take a look at it now.  It looks similar to the Mazda 3.</p>
<p>25/30 is good gas mileage.  I actually have three cars that were high on my list after the OC Auto Show:</p>
<p>Toyota Prius 51/48 &#8211; great gas mileage and roomy interior.<br />
Scion xB 22/28 &#8211; not very good gas mileage.  Very roomy interior.  Low price.  Test drove the manual and it was fun to drive.<br />
Mini Clubman 28/37 &#8211; good gas mileage for a non-hybrid.  Interior might be too small for dogs. Fun to drive.  Price can be a little high if you start adding options</p>
<p>I was looking at the <a href="http://puppyintraining.com/jeep-wrangler-unlimited-2008-dog-car-for-the-off-roading-outdoorsmen/" rel="nofollow">Jeep Wrangler</a>, but after talking to people, reading consumer reports, and hearing about the maintenance issues I decided to take it off my list.  Also, the gas mileage would have killed me.</p>
